Dr. Daley graduated from the Tulane University School of Medicine in 1986. He works in Knoxville, TN and 3 other locations and specializes in Trauma Surgery, Surgery and Critical Care Medicine. Dr. Daley is affiliated with University Of Tennessee Medical Center.
